Manhattan Toy adds Quadrilla rights
By Staff -- Gifts and Dec, 2/4/2010 1:21:00 AM
MINNEAPOLIS—Manhattan Toy has inked a worldwide licensing and distribution agreement for Quadrilla line of wooden marble runs and accessories from its German maker.
"We are delighted to have secured this new partnership," said Manhattan Toy president Mike Klein. "Manhattan Toy is dedicated to the art of creative play and quality craftsmanship so the link with Quadrilla makes perfect sense. Both brands share a mission to inspire and enrich young lives and developing minds."
The Quadrilla brand is owned by Quadrilla Spielzeug Design und Herstellung. The line debuted in 2002. It was most recently marketed in the U.S. by HaPe International.
